Understanding Human Anatomy and Physiology



Definition of Anatomy and Physiology



Anatomy is the branch of biology that deals with the structure of organisms and their parts. It can be divided into two main categories:

1. Gross Anatomy: The study of structures visible to the naked eye.
2. Microscopic Anatomy: The study of structures that require magnification, such as cells and tissues.

Physiology, on the other hand, focuses on the functions and processes of the body’s systems. It examines how various systems interact and maintain homeostasis, the state of internal balance necessary for survival.

The Relationship Between Anatomy and Physiology



Anatomy and physiology are closely intertwined; understanding one often requires knowledge of the other. For example, the anatomy of the heart—its chambers, valves, and blood vessels—directly informs its physiological functions, such as blood circulation and oxygenation. This interrelationship is fundamental to the study of health and disease.

Effective Teaching Strategies for Tutors



To be effective, human anatomy and physiology tutors should employ a variety of teaching strategies tailored to individual learning styles. Some effective techniques include:

1. Visual Aids



Utilizing diagrams, models, and animations can help students visualize complex structures and processes. Many students benefit from seeing the physical layout of organs and systems.

2. Interactive Learning



Engaging students in hands-on activities, such as dissection or simulation software, can deepen their understanding of anatomical structures and physiological functions.

3. Real-World Applications



Connecting theoretical concepts to real-life scenarios helps students appreciate the importance of what they are learning. Discussing clinical cases or health-related issues can make the material more relevant.

4. Regular Assessments



Conducting quizzes and practice exams can help reinforce knowledge and identify areas that require further study. Regular assessments also help students adapt to exam formats.

5. Encouraging Questions



Creating an open environment where students feel comfortable asking questions fosters a deeper understanding of the material. Tutors should encourage inquiry and curiosity.
